What does a Computer Aided Design (CAD) Manager do?

A Computer Aided Design (CAD) Manager oversees the implementation, maintenance, and optimization of CAD systems within an organization. They are responsible for managing CAD software, developing standards and best practices, training staff, and ensuring the accuracy and efficiency of design processes. CAD Managers also collaborate with engineering and design teams to streamline workflow, resolve technical issues, and facilitate project delivery. Their role is essential for leveraging technology to enhance productivity and maintain quality in design projects.

What is the difference between Computer Aided Design Manager vs CAD Technician?

AspectComputer Aided Design ManagerCAD Technician
CredentialsBachelor's degree in engineering, architecture, or related field; experience in CAD software managementAssociate's or bachelor's degree; proficiency in CAD software
Work EnvironmentOversees CAD teams, manages projects, collaborates with engineers and architectsPerforms drafting, modeling, and drawing creation under supervision
Industry UsageUsed in engineering, architecture, manufacturing, and construction firmsCommonly employed in similar industries for detailed design work

The main difference is that a Computer Aided Design Manager oversees CAD teams and manages projects, while a CAD Technician focuses on creating detailed drawings and models. The manager has more responsibilities in planning and coordination, whereas the technician specializes in technical drafting tasks.

Job Description:

 

In a fast moving and increasingly complex world, L3Harris is anticipating and rapidly responding to challenges with agile technology - creating a safer and more secure future. L3Harris is seeking a dynamic Mechanical Engineer who will design and manufacture electronic data acquisition systems for use in Anti-Submarine Warfare, ship self-defense, acoustic ranges and geophysical exploration products. They utilize CAD software to create blueprints, perform simulations to ensure safety and efficiency, and oversee production to meet project specifications.

Essential Functions:

 

  • Implement assigned projects and project tasks to provide mechanical engineering solutions including: mechanical design, parts selection, CAD and modeling, stress analysis, thermal analysis, environmental impacts, packaging and assembly and test equipment design for assigned project.
  • Extensive experience with CAD and FEA software to perform mechanical design and analysis is required.
  • Ensure that assigned project tasks meet technical and schedule requirements. Identify problems and recommend work around plans and alternatives.
  • Provide technical status, forecast technical needs and recommend changes as necessary to meet objectives.
  • Prepare tradeoff models and candidates for evaluation.
  • Conduct thorough design analyses including interface design, models, equipment prototypes and R&D test tools.
  • Provide system test and evaluation support including input to test plans and procedures.
  • Prepare engineering drawings and documents.
  • Direct and coordinate activities for product assembly / fabrication, equipment operation and/or installation and repair of mechanical or electromechanical products and systems.  Responsible for following sound safety practices as documented in the company's quality system manual.
  • Implement check and balance procedures to monitor, review and evaluate design activities performed to assure conformance with customer requirements, company standards and sound engineering practices.
  • Select materials necessary to support the design.
  • Develop manufacturing and producibility analyses.
  • Ensure that the design is fully compliant with customer specifications.
  • Perform failure analyses and document results.
  • Prepare design review material in support of PDR, CDR, FDR and technical audits for assigned designs.
  • Develop, issue, and implement internal technical and engineering practices and procedures.
  • Promote cordial relationships and foster and maintain a favorable business profile with customers, suppliers, co-workers, industry and professional associations, government agencies and the local community.
  • Ability to obtain and maintain a US Government Security Clearance.

 

Qualifications:

  • Bachelor's Degree and minimum 4 years of prior relevant experience. Graduate Degree and a minimum of 2 years of prior related experience. In lieu of a degree, minimum of 8 years of prior related experience.
  • Minimum 2 years of hands-on mechanical design experience, including CAD modeling, design analysis, and engineering drawing preparation.
  • Proficiency in CAD software (Autodesk Inventor or other comparable platforms such as SolidWorks or CATIA) with demonstrated ability to produce engineering drawings, assembly models, and design documentation.
  • Experience supporting fabrication, assembly, and/or production environments, including coordinating product build activities, troubleshooting mechanical issues, and ensuring designs meet customer and manufacturing specifications.
